Agricultural Machinery Mobile Repair Conducted for 84 Villages During Farming Season

[Gurye=Asia Economy Honam Reporting Headquarters Reporter Yuk Miseok] Jeollanam-do Gurye-gun announced on the 8th that it has started a mobile agricultural machinery repair service in remote villages to resolve repair inconveniences caused by agricultural machinery breakdowns and support timely farming as the full-scale farming season begins.


This mobile agricultural machinery repair service will start from Gurye-eup and Masan-myeon and directly visit 84 villages in hard-to-access areas until the end of October.


Starting this year, the mobile agricultural machinery repair team has been expanded to 2 teams with 4 members, providing a total of 168 mobile repair services twice a year per village.


During the mobile repair service, major agricultural machinery such as tillers, cultivators, sprayers, and brush cutters can be repaired directly in the respective villages, which has received great responses from farmers every year.


The target villages for the mobile repair service and detailed schedules can be checked through the Ban newsletter and the Agricultural Technology Center Rental Business Office.


A county official said, “We will continue to actively support the mobile agricultural machinery repair service to alleviate repair inconveniences and rural labor shortages and ensure timely farming.”
